TRUCKS & TRACTORS

 Trucks & Tractors

Learning Targets

I can...

  • Create an original Trucks & Tractors using painting techniques learned in class
  • Use line types (horizontal vertical diagonal), shape variation (geometric organic), and space (positive negative) inspired by Scottish Artist (2013-Present) Victoria Grant
  • Use drawing techniques (observational, contour, outline) and design principles (composition repetition balance) based on Contemporary Art
  • Define Transportation (carry something from one place to another by means of vehicle)

Lesson Activities

1. Choose 12" X 15" White Drawing Paper

2. Use geometric shapes (triangles, circles, rectangles) to draw the exterior (outside) of the tractor composition

3. Use geometric shapes (triangles, circles, rectangles) to draw the main parts (wheels, cab, headlights) of the Trucks & Tractors

Lesson Activities

1. Use line types (contour, outline, continuous) to outline with neutral colors (black, grey, brown) the tractor composition 

2 Add decorative patterns (dots, stripes, swirls) to the positive space (tractor) of the tractor composition

3. Add line types (contour, outline, continuous) to the negative space (background) of the tractor compositions 

Day Three, Art Start

1. Retrieve Trucks & Tractors for Assigned Table

2. Set Up Studio Area (watercolor, paintbrushes, buckets)

Lesson Activities

1. Use warm colors (red orange yellow) to fill in the negative space (background) of the tractor composition

2. Use cool colors (blue green purple) to fill in the positive space (foreground) of the tractor composition

3. Add highlights (lightness, darkness) to the positives space (foreground) of the tractor composition
